Aspic Jelly for Sandwiches
A classic aspic jelly recipe, perfect for sandwiches.
Ingredients
- 1 box (2 ounces) Gelatin
- 4 cups Chicken broth (Quantity estimated (not specified in original recipe))
- 1/2 cup Vegetables (carrots, celery, onion) (Quantity estimated (not specified in original recipe))
- 1 tablespoon Sweet herbs (parsley, thyme, bay leaf) (Quantity estimated (not specified in original recipe))
- 1 egg Egg white, crushed shell
